Under normal market conditions, the fund invests at least 65% of its total assets in stocks, primarily common stock. It invests principally in stocks within the Russell 1000® Value Index universe that have an above average dividend yield. The fund seeks a higher return than the index over time through a combination of capital appreciation and dividend income. It may invest a significant amount of its assets from time to time in the financial and technology sector.

The Fund will invest at least 90% of its total assets in common stocks that comprise the Index. Standard & Poor's compiles, maintains and calculates the Index, which is composed of 50 securities traded on the S&P 500 Index that historically have provided high dividend yields and low volatility. The Fund and the Index are rebalanced and reconstituted semi-annually, in January and July.
